Tantalum Capacitors

The F951E225MSAAQ2 is a type of tantalum capacitor. A tantalum capacitor is a device used in electronic circuits for applications such as decoupling, smoothing, and other power line filtering purposes. This type of capacitor is a polarized capacitor, and is a widely used form of electronics components.

Working Principle

Tantalum capacitors, of which the F951E225MSAAQ2 is one, work the same way as any other type of polarized electrolytic capacitor. That is, they are composed of two conducting metal plates separated by an insulating material, with one plate operating as the cathode and the other as the anode. In this type, the anode is made up of tantalum metal and is covered in an oxide layer. The oxide layer acts as an electrical insulator, preventing current from flowing between the two metal plates.

When a voltage is applied to the capacitor, electrons from the anode are attracted towards the cathode, which causes a charge imbalance between the two metal plates. This creates an electric field between the plates, which is then stored as an electrical energy inside the capacitor. When the voltage is taken away from the capacitor, the stored electrical energy is slowly leaked from the capacitor, slowly decreasing the charge imbalance between the two plates, and slowly dissipating the electric field.

The F951E225MSAAQ2 capacitor operates at a wide range of temperatures, making it suitable for use in most applications. This type of capacitor is widely used in telecommunication systems, industrial control systems, and medical equipment, and has many advantages compared to other types of capacitors. Some of these advantages include low impedance and small size, making them suitable for use in systems where space is at a premium.
